What makes a logo file production-ready?

A useful master logo should remain recognizable at small sizes, work on light and dark surfaces, avoid unnecessary raster artifacts, and be available in a scalable or high-resolution source. Transparency and controlled file weight make everyday placement easier.

This grader evaluates the uploaded file rather than judging the creative idea. A technically excellent export can still be generic, inaccessible in its final context, or legally risky. Use the result as a QA checklist, not a design verdict.

How the score works

Resolution contributes 20 points, contrast 20, transparency 15, color control 15, format 10, file weight 10, and practical proportions 10. PNG and WebP receive the strongest supported format score. JPEG is marked down because it cannot preserve transparency and often introduces edge noise.
